I picked up a used (privately owned but had never even been loaded) Sig Sauer P238 380 today, to carry in my pocket when one of my larger handguns will be more difficult to conceal. The book says the magazine holds a capacity of 6 with one in the pipe. My problem is if I put 4 or more in the magazine it won't load a shell properly when I work the slide. It works fine with 3 in the magazine and 1 in the pipe, but I really don't want a 4 shot hand gun. On the other hand I don't want to load to capacity then get in a shtf situation only to have the next bullet not load properly. I've loaded it with Remington Golden Saber HPJ, which is all Mark's had available when I stopped to pick up some ammo. I lubrixated the slide but that didn't help. Could it be due to the stiffness of the new spring in the magazine? What do y'all think? Thanks.
